Like
its counterparts in automobiles and electronics, Shimano is constantly evolving
its products, and now showcases the ‘next’ in technological advancements in the
new Stella FJ reels. The flagship in Shimano’s spinning reel line-up, the five
new models - in sizes for everything from trout and panfish, to bass and
walleye, to tarpon, stripers and sailfish, include the Stella (STL) 1000FJ,
STL-2500HGFJ, STL-C3000XGFJ, STL-4000XGFJ and STL-C5000XGFJ.
Setting
it apart from past series, anglers will quickly notice new Shimano technology,
including MicroModule II gear system, enhanced HAGANE concept constructed gear
and body, X-Protect and SilentDrive.
